The Facade Project

The Facade Project started in October 2017 and is getting the conversation started on the real struggles people face on their journey to success.     Season 2 | Ep. 10 - Healing is a Life long Journey w/ Mental Therapist Ravina Wadhwani

    Introducing Ravina Whadwani!! Licensed Mental Health Therapist & healer comes on the show to talk about the stigmas centered around mental health, what to do to support a friend or family member who needs mental healing or therapy & much more. Ravina is doing good work in the world of non-profit! She has a great sense of self even when working with her clients, knowing when to check in and check out, leaving her day at the door. I loved our conversation centered around how important it is to focus on your mental well-being.     Season 2 | Ep. 9 - Never Giving Up on Love w/Married Couple & Musician Drew Anthuny/Yaritza Estrada

    Today on the podcast I bring on Artist/Musician Drew Anthuny & his Wife, Blogger, Yaritza Estrada who talk growing up in LA, the ups and downs of figuring out who you are as an Artist, Love and supporting your partner through everything & not letting your ego or masculinity (MEN) get in the way of a good woman’s love. Yaritza & Drew support each other, you can feel the warmth and love between them & although the main focus was centered around Drew & his music, I had to bring Yaritza in for a little advice to millennials in relationships!     Season 2 | Ep. 8 - You Always Have Something Different to Offer w/Actress Jasmine Reid

    Introducing Actress, Jasmine Reid to the Show! Jasmine was born and raised in Memphis, TN and moved out to LA to work towards an acting career! Find out how Jasmine went from studying to be a Physical Therapist, to landing roles in the Industry! We talk through what it's really like to be a working actor in Hollywood, the No's the trials & tribulations & the steps to take in getting there. The most inspiring part of this episode is when Jasmine talks about the steps to take in moving to LA to become an actor.
